The Process of Professional Digital Recovery
A genuine recovery operation is seldom a rapid "click-of-a-button" occasion. It is a methodical process that involves a number of technical phases.
1. The Initial Assessment
The specialist needs to first figure out if healing is even possible. For instance, if a cryptocurrency private secret is really lost and no "ideas" (parts of the secret) exist, the laws of mathematics might make recovery difficult. Throughout this phase, the professional examines the architecture of the lockout.
2. Verification of Ownership
Ethical healing specialists will never ever attempt to "crack" an account without evidence of ownership. This is a crucial security check. The customer must offer identification, evidence of purchase, or historic information that confirms their right to the property.
3. Investigation and Vulnerability Mapping
The technical work starts by recognizing the "weakest link" in the security chain. In social media healing, this may involve recognizing the phishing link used by the aggressor. In data recovery, it involves scanning the sectors of a physical hard disk drive to discover residues of file headers.
4. Execution and Restoration
Using specific hardware or custom-coded scripts, the expert efforts to bypass or reset the security procedures. This may include high-speed computations to guess missing parts of a password or negotiating with platform security teams using top-level technical documentation.
How to Identify a Legitimate Recovery Professional
The "healing" industry is unfortunately a magnet for scammers. Numerous bad actors promise to "hack back" taken funds just to take more money from the victim. To secure oneself, an extensive vetting procedure is required.
List for Hiring a Recovery Expert:Verified Track Record: Does the private or company have proven evaluations or an existence on reliable platforms like LinkedIn or cybersecurity forums?Transparent Pricing: Avoid services that require large "preliminary software application costs" or "gas fees" upfront without a clear contract. Legitimate specialists often work on a base cost plus a success-percentage model.Communication Professionalism: A legitimate specialist will explain the technical restrictions and never ever ensure 100% success.No Request for Sensitive Credentials: A professional need to never ever request for your current main passwords or other unassociated private secrets. They ought to direct you through the process of resetting them.Comparing Professional Recovery vs. Automated Tools

When browsing for recovery assistance, particular expressions and habits should serve as instant warnings. The internet is rife with "Recovery Room Scams," where fraudsters posture as valuable hackers.
Surefire Results: In cybersecurity, there are no guarantees. If somebody assures a 100% success rate on a lost Bitcoin wallet, they are likely lying.Uncommon Payment Methods: Stay away from "specialists" who demand being paid via untraceable methods like Western Union, present cards, or direct crypto transfers before any work is performed.Pressure Tactics: If the professional claims the property will be "completely deleted" unless you pay them within the next hour, it is a timeless extortion method.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1.
